How To Write Resume For Delivery Helper
- Highlight your skills in route optimization, customer service, and team management.
- Quantify your accomplishments with specific metrics, such as the percentage reduction in delivery times or the number of customer complaints resolved.
- Showcase your experience in handling high-value or sensitive shipments, emphasizing your ability to maintain confidentiality and ensure secure delivery.
- Use keywords throughout your resume that are relevant to the Delivery Helper role, such as ‘delivery optimization,’ ‘customer relations,’ and ‘inventory management.’

What are the qualifications for becoming a Delivery Helper?
The qualifications for becoming a Delivery Helper typically include a high school diploma or equivalent, a valid driver’s license, and a clean driving record. Some employers may prefer candidates with a Bachelor’s Degree in Supply Chain Management or a related field.
What is the work environment of a Delivery Helper like?
Delivery Helpers typically work in a fast-paced and physically demanding environment. They spend most of their time driving and making deliveries, and they may also be responsible for loading and unloading heavy items.
What is the career outlook for Delivery Helpers?
The career outlook for Delivery Helpers is expected to be good over the next few years. The increasing demand for online shopping and home deliveries is expected to drive job growth in this field.

What are some common interview questions for Delivery Helpers?
Some common interview questions for Delivery Helpers include:
- Tell me about your experience in route optimization.
- How do you handle difficult customers?
- How do you manage a team of delivery drivers?
- What is your experience in handling high-value or sensitive shipments?
- How do you use real-time tracking systems to monitor delivery progress and anticipate potential delays?
